The Aga Khan University Hospital is a not-for-profit healthcare institute that offers all medical services to their patients under one roof. In addition to the tertiary care hospital in Karachi, AKUH has a network of 4 secondary care hospitals, 30+ Medical Centres, and over 290+ Clinical Laboratories, 30+ Pharmacies in over 120+ cities across Pakistan. It also offers Home Healthcare Services and home deliveries of medicines. The Hospital provides Zakat for those patients who are eligible, and the health systems offers generous Patient Welfare to support those in financial need. In recognition of its high quality and patient safety, the AKUH is accredited by the Joint Commission International (JCI) as an Academic Medical Centre and its Clinical Laboratories are accredited by the College of American Pathologists (CAP) for fast and accurate testing.

To be responsible for integrating the hospital strategic plan with operations to ensure the smooth and efficient functioning of the hospital, including management of the profit and loss statement for the hospital’s business, as well as the related resources associated with the hospital operation to deliver best healthcare services to the patients and achieving financial sustainability.
Responsibilities:
- To execute an operational plan for the hospital to provide outstanding healthcare services to the patients and increase patient numbers in OPD/ IPD.
- To ensure the smooth operational working of the hospital and provide necessary guidelines to the hospital team for smooth functioning of hospital operations.
- To ensure the preparation of proposals with estimates for new projects of construction, renovation, general repair, and maintenance as defined in the hospital five five-year plan.
- To participate in the strategic and operational planning process under the leadership of the CEO of Teaching Hospitals.
- To ensure the availability of competent human resources based on workload and healthcare standards within approved budgets and supervise staff training and development for outstanding performance.
- To execute CEO Teaching Hospitals initiatives for the transformation of Hospital culture which encourages positivity, supporting others, sharing knowledge, taking responsibilities, flexibility for change, and empowerment, to deliver excellent patient-centered care.
- To collaborate with communities, educational institutes, and NGOs for Healthcare awareness campaigns, arranging Medical campuses and attracting patients for the hospital.
- To Provide leadership support to the Manager Operations to ensure the best facility management, Ambulance Services, Transport, Hostels, and Cafeteria for the best healthcare and support services for patients and staff.
- To ensure execution of preventive maintenance plan for biomedical equipment to ensure the smooth functioning of biomedical equipment in the hospital.
- To ensure supply chain management with the proper planning process of Medical and Non-Medical items for the smooth functioning of the hospital department for patient care.
- To participate in the budget planning process for the Hospital and facilitate CEO Teaching Hospitals for arranging approval of the operating budget for the financial year.
- To ensure that Hospitals' financials are managed within budget guidelines and according to the financial policies and compliance to the laws.
- To achieve Revenue and Profitability targets of the hospitals through best quality of healthcare services and closely monitor the progress on a weekly, Monthly, Quarterly, and Yearly basis.
- To ensure delivery of cost-effective healthcare services through the design and implementation of process improvement, effective purchasing, and optimal resource utilization within budget parameters.
- To ensure the effective implementation of technology integration and hospital operations (Clinical / Non–Clinical) via HIMS/ SAP.
- To ensure delivery of the best medical and nursing care to patients and planning rounds of OPD, Wards, OT, Pharmacy, and Lab for consistent monitoring and improving healthcare services.
- To ensure the execution of marketing strategies to promote the best healthcare services of the hospital with more focus on social media for achieving the revenue targets with consistent growth of list of panels and cash patients as defined in the RHS five-year plan of the hospital.
- To ensure ISO 9001: 2015 Quality standards are implemented in true letter and spirit and periodic audits are successful with the highest scores with no deviations.
- To ensure that operational plans for best quality healthcare services are in place for the patients and ensuring outstanding patient experience in outpatient and Inpatient services through quality medical and nursing care.
- To ensure administration of quality documentation, management of quality audits, and implementation of audit points with coordination of Directorate TQM.
- To execute of quality undergraduate and postgraduate teaching programs in line with the guidelines of (PMDC/CPSP).
- Continuous Medical Education Programs with mandatory training hours for Medical and Nursing staff are implemented and its impact on patient care is measured.
- To ensure the implementation of the Riphah Mission and Islamic Ethical Values in true spirit for staff at Teaching Hospitals by developing and monitoring mechanisms where these values are reflected in every course of action and behavior.
Key Competencies:
- Financial Management and Sustainability
- Strategic Planning and Implementation
- Healthcare Quality standards i.e. JCI / Accreditation Canada
- Information Technology / HIMS
